Two-nucleon knockout spectroscopy at the limits of nuclear stability.
Sudden single-nucleon removal reactions from fast radioactive beams are now key to studies of the structure of rare isotopes. The sensitivity of the heavy residue's parallel momentum distribution to the orbital angular momentum of the removed nucleon is a crucial feature with a high spectroscopic value. Two-nucleon removal reactions provide experimental reach toward the rarest nuclear species. ...

متن کاملSpectroscopy of 13 , 14 B via the one - neutron knockout reaction
The single-nucleon knockout reactions Be(B,B1g)X and Au(B,B1g)X , at an incident energy of 60 MeV per nucleon, have been used to probe the structure of B and of the core fragment B. A dominant 2s configuration is deduced for the neutron in the ground state of B. The longitudinal momentum distribution for this state is consistent with ‘‘neutron halo’’ structure.
